Rawacou Recreational Park is a hidden gem located in Argyle, St. Vincent and the Grenadines, that offers visitors an incredible opportunity to connect with nature. Spanning expansive green areas, the park is adorned with native flora and fauna, creating a tranquil atmosphere perfect for a day of exploration. As you stroll through the well-maintained trails, keep your eyes peeled for a diverse array of bird species, making it a haven for birdwatchers and wildlife enthusiasts alike. The vibrant ecosystems provide a lush backdrop for photography and quiet contemplation. For those who enjoy outdoor activities, Rawacou Recreational Park is an excellent choice. The park features numerous trails that cater to various skill levels, inviting both casual walkers and avid hikers to traverse its scenic paths. Families can enjoy leisurely picnics in designated areas, surrounded by the sights and sounds of nature. With the sun shining above and a gentle breeze rustling through the trees, it’s the perfect place to unwind and recharge. The park is open every day from 9 AM to 5 PM, allowing ample time for visitors to fully immerse themselves in its beauty. While exploring, be sure to carry plenty of water and snacks to keep your energy up. Whether you're seeking solitude or a fun outing with family and friends, Rawacou Recreational Park promises an enriching experience that captures the essence of St. Vincent's natural charm.
Local tips
- Visit early in the morning or late afternoon for the best wildlife spotting opportunities.
- Bring a picnic to enjoy at one of the many scenic spots throughout the park.
- Wear comfortable walking shoes to navigate the park's trails easily.
- Check the weather beforehand as rain can make trails slippery.
- Don't forget your camera to capture the breathtaking views and wildlife!
